Each pod holds enough coffee to make 1 cup, so no measuring is needed. The machine has a reservoir for water and an interior cup in which to place the pod. The machine heats the water, pierces the foil top of the pod and forces water through the coffee grounds inside it. The coffee drips directly into your cup, which sits underneath the spout.

Step 6 Fine grind. Fine grinding is performed with a wheel that has a higher grit than the previous step, such as a 220 diamond grinding wheel. This wheel continues to shape your cabochon and removes the scratches left on your stone from the wheel before. Just like the previous step, completely grind the surface of the stone.
Sep 20, 2018 Worn wheels also make the machine spindle work harder, putting it under unnecessary stress. Keep collets clean and in good condition. This rule may sound like a no-brainer, but Mr. Richardson says many grinding shops use collets with grinding marks on the nose and dirt inside the collet. Sometimes shops hang on to collets too long.
Mar 22, 2021 Make sure the grinder is tightly secured to the bench. Check that the tool rest is in place on the grinder. The tool rest is where the metal item will rest as you grind it. The rest should be secured in place so there is a 18 inch 3 mm space between it and the grinding wheel. Clear the area around the grinder of objects and debris.

Pivot the grinding head slowly across the stump by rolling the unlocked wheel forward and back. Shut the engine off after removing about 4 to 6 in. of stump, then roll the machine forward, reset the brake and resume grinding. It usually takes about 45 minutes to grind a 20-in. oak stump. Plane grinding ensures that the surfaces of all specimens are similar, despite their initial condition and their previous treatment. In addition, when processing several specimens in a holder, care must be taken to make sure they are all at the same level, or plane, before progressing to the next step, fine grinding.
